Write a test plan
Turn a product or code change into a risk-based test plan with environments, cases, ownership, and release evidence.
Design checks around what could harm a user or invalidate the release decision. Prefer a small set of high-information tests over a long list of generic cases.
Inputs
- Read the requirement, design, diff, interfaces, acceptance criteria, and known incidents.
- Name the supported environments, data classifications, test owner, and release decision maker.
- Record what is explicitly out of scope and which assumptions still need confirmation.
Procedure
- Describe the critical user journeys and the observable result that makes each one successful.
- Identify risks by impact and likelihood: incorrect results, lost data, unauthorized access, incompatibility, degraded performance, inaccessible interaction, and confusing recovery.
- Build a coverage matrix connecting each material risk to one or more checks. Remove cases that do not change a release decision.
- Define layers deliberately: deterministic unit checks, boundary or contract checks, integration checks, end-to-end journeys, and focused manual exploration.
- Specify data and environment needs without copying private production data. Include setup, reset, isolation, and cleanup instructions.
- Write each important case with preconditions, action, expected observation, and evidence to retain. Include negative, empty, boundary, repeat, interruption, and recovery cases where relevant.
- Mark which cases block release, which can follow later, and who owns each result.
- Define entry criteria, exit criteria, and the process for recording defects, retests, waivers, and residual risks.
- Rehearse one representative case from setup through evidence capture. Revise ambiguous instructions.
- Store the plan beside the change and keep a concise execution record as cases run.
Boundaries
Do not turn the plan into an unprioritized checklist. Never use sensitive user data without permission and a handling plan. Do not call a release tested when blocking environments or journeys were skipped; record the gap and decision owner instead.
